The Chamber of the Well. The Chamber of the Well (Hebrew, Gola) is one of the chambers in the northern part of the Court. From this chamber, water was supplied for use in the Court. This chamber was called Gola (diaspora) because it was built by people who returned from exile in Babylon.

The first kohen, the founder of the priestly clan, was Aharon, brother of Moshe, of the tribe of Levi. All of Israel are descended from the twelve sons of Yaakov. Yaakov's third son was Levi, and Aharon was a fourth generation descendant of Levi. Aharon and his four sons were designated as the first kohanim; Aharon served as the first Kohen Gadol.

According to Rashi, the weight of silver was 7 grams. Since the value of silver fluctuates, it is necessary to recalculate the current value each year. For example, in the year 2013 (Hebrew year: 5773) the value of the silver half-shekel was between 30 to 40 ILS. However, in contrast to this fixed amount, in the beginning of the Second Temple ...
